If you are a resident of Iowa you must get an Iowa Permit to Carry Weapons. Only non-residents can carry with permits from other states What do you think would happen if I was carrying in Iowa with just my Arizona permit? I am going to guess the same thing that happens to someone who doesn't have a permit, arrest, charged etc.... Copy from Iowa code: 724.4 CARRYING WEAPONS.
1. Except as otherwise provided in this section, a person who goes armed with a dangerous weapon concealed on or about the person, or who, within the limits of any city, goes armed with a pistol or revolver, or any loaded firearm of any kind, whether concealed or not, or who knowingly carries or transports in a vehicle a pistol or revolver, commits an aggravated misdemeanor. |
